Transaction 2c7773fee46816a6e65f2714f4a3a76618aa7df3e9e6df728da264ff89bace23

3 Input
1 Outputs
  • 2c7773fee46816a6e65f2714f4a3a76618aa7df3e9e6df728da264ff89bace23:0
  • value  5998552
    address  3CG1h3s2qZ8rjatpEi7pa6ZNH8zb5vj7rT